Overview of NXP PC74HC132D
The NXP PC74HC132D is a high-speed Si-gate CMOS device that belongs to a family of robust quadruple positive-edge triggered two-input Schmitt-trigger NAND gates. This integrated circuit is designed to operate in a broad range of operating conditions and provides a perfect solution for applications that require noise-coupling reduction and wave shaping with high noise immunity.
Key Features
- Logic Type: The device features quadruple two-input NAND gates with Schmitt-trigger action at all inputs to make it tolerant to slower input rise and fall times.
- Operating Voltage: It operates across a wide voltage range from 2 V to 6 V, providing flexible power supply options suitable for various logic level integrations.
- High Noise Immunity: The inherent hysteresis of Schmitt triggers offers enhanced noise immunity and allows the device to be used in noisy environments.
- Compatibility: The PC74HC132D is TTL compatible at 5V and can be used in mixed 5V and 3.3V environments.
- Speed: Its fast switching characteristics make it suitable for high-speed applications.
- Package: The product is available in a standard SO14 package, which is suitable for surface mount technology (SMT).
- Temperature Range: The device can operate over a wide temperature range, making it suitable for industrial and automotive applications.
Applications
The versatility of the NXP PC74HC132D allows it to be used across a diverse set of applications. These include:
- Wave and pulse shapers
- Astable multivibrators
- Monostable multivibrators
- Circuit buffering
- Glitch-free switching circuits
- Input interface circuits with high noise immunity requirements
